Responsibilities
- Patient Assessment & Care: Conduct comprehensive initial and ongoing assessments to evaluate patient health status and develop individualized care plans.
- Medication Administration: Safely administer prescribed medications and treatments in strict accordance with hospital protocols and safety standards.
- Documentation: Maintain accurate, timely, and detailed electronic health records (EHR) and clinical documentation.
- Collaboration: Work collaboratively with physicians, therapists, and interdisciplinary teams to optimize patient outcomes.
- Patient Advocacy: Serve as a fierce advocate for patient rights, ensuring dignity, comfort, and safety during hospital stays.
- Education: Educate patients and families on disease management, discharge planning, and post-care instructions.
Qualifications
- Education: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) preferred; Associate Degree in Nursing (ADN) accepted for New Grads.
- Licensure: Valid and unencumbered Registered Nurse (RN) license issued by the California Board of Registered Nursing.
- Certifications: Basic Life Support (BLS) and Advanced Cardiovascular Life Support (ACLS) certification required at hire.
- Experience: No prior professional experience required; New Grads with successful clinical rotations are encouraged to apply.
- Skills: Strong critical thinking, excellent verbal and written communication skills, and the ability to work under pressure.
- Physical Requirements: Ability to lift up to 50 lbs, stand for extended periods, and perform physical maneuvers required for patient care.
